Why Freelancers Look for HoneyBook Alternatives
HoneyBook does a lot well - beautiful proposals, smooth contracts, easy invoicing. But common frustrations push people to look elsewhere:
Not built for every industry. HoneyBook shines for photographers, planners, and designers. If you're a developer, consultant, or marketer, the templates and workflows feel off.
Limited project management. Once a client is booked, HoneyBook's project tracking is basic. No task boards, no detailed timelines, no developer-friendly workflows.
No real status updates. Clients can see invoices and contracts in the portal, but there's no dedicated way to share ongoing project progress.
Pricing tiers lock features. Automation and advanced features require higher plans. The $16/month starter is limited.
Client login required. Every client needs a HoneyBook account to access the portal. Some freelancers want simpler access.
Your ideal HoneyBook alternative depends on which of these pain points matters most.

1. Dubsado - Best for Automation
If HoneyBook's automation feels limited, Dubsado is the upgrade.
What It Does
Dubsado is a CRM with powerful multi-step workflow automation. Create sequences that trigger emails, contracts, invoices, tasks, and more based on client actions or time delays.
Key Features
- Multi-step workflow automation (significantly more powerful than HoneyBook)
- Custom forms and questionnaires
- Proposals with interactive pricing
- Contracts with e-signatures
- Invoicing and payment processing
- Scheduling integration
- Client portal
Why Choose Over HoneyBook
Dubsado's automation is in a different league. Build workflows like: "When proposal is accepted - send contract - when signed - send invoice - when paid - send welcome email - create project - assign tasks." HoneyBook can do basic versions of this, but Dubsado goes deeper.
Pricing
- Starter: $20/month (3 workflows)
- Premier: $40/month (unlimited workflows)
Trade-offs
- Steep learning curve (many users take courses)
- Interface feels dated compared to HoneyBook
- Takes significant setup time
- Less beautiful out of the box
Best For: Process-driven freelancers who want to automate everything and are willing to invest time building systems.
2. Bonsai - Best for Business Management
If you need contracts, invoicing, AND accounting/tax prep, Bonsai covers more ground than HoneyBook.
What It Does
Bonsai is a freelancer business suite: contracts, proposals, invoicing, time tracking, expense tracking, accounting, and tax prep. It focuses on the business side of freelancing.
Key Features
- Contract and proposal templates
- Invoicing with payment processing
- Time tracking
- Expense tracking and accounting
- Tax prep and estimated payments
- Basic client portal
- Workflow automation
Why Choose Over HoneyBook
Bonsai includes accounting and tax features HoneyBook doesn't touch. If you're a freelancer handling your own finances, having contracts, invoicing, expenses, and tax estimates in one place saves time and money.
Pricing
- Starter: $21/month
- Professional: $32/month
- Business: $52/month
Trade-offs
- Client portal is basic
- Less beautiful proposals than HoneyBook
- Not as creative-industry focused
- Can feel cluttered with features
Best For: Freelancers who want business management (contracts + invoicing + accounting) in one tool, especially those who do their own taxes.
3. Copilot (Assembly) - Best Client Portal
If HoneyBook's client portal feels limited, Copilot (now Assembly) is the dedicated portal tool.
What It Does
Copilot builds polished client portals with messaging, file sharing, billing, and help desk. It's purpose-built for the client-facing experience.
Key Features
- Professional client portals
- Built-in messaging
- File sharing and organization
- Billing and invoicing
- Help desk / support
- App integrations
- White-label options
Why Choose Over HoneyBook
Copilot's portal experience is significantly more polished. If client-facing professionalism is your priority - and you handle contracts/proposals elsewhere - Copilot delivers a better portal than HoneyBook.
Pricing
- Starter: $29/user/month
- Professional: $69/user/month
- Advanced: $119/user/month
Trade-offs
- Per-user pricing gets expensive fast
- No built-in contracts or proposals
- No scheduling or booking
- Less focused on acquisition, more on delivery
Best For: Agencies wanting the best possible client portal experience who handle contracts and proposals with other tools.
4. Plutio - Best Customizable All-in-One
If you want HoneyBook's breadth but with more flexibility and customization, Plutio delivers.
What It Does
Plutio combines projects, proposals, contracts, invoicing, time tracking, and a client portal with deep customization options. Shape it to match exactly how you work.
Key Features
- Project management (tasks, boards, Gantt)
- Proposals and contracts with e-sign
- Invoicing and recurring billing
- Time tracking
- Client portal with white-label
- Custom fields and workflows
- Wiki / knowledge base
Why Choose Over HoneyBook
More flexible and customizable. Plutio lets you build custom fields, create unique workflows, and configure the platform to your exact process. HoneyBook is more opinionated about how you should work.
Pricing
- Solo: $19/month
- Studio: $39/month
- Agency: $99/month
Trade-offs
- Less beautiful out of the box
- Not as focused on creative industries
- Customization takes time
- Smaller community and ecosystem
Best For: Freelancers who want an all-in-one they can customize extensively, especially those who find HoneyBook too rigid.
5. SuiteDash - Best Value for Teams
If HoneyBook's pricing worries you as your team grows, SuiteDash's flat-rate model is the answer.
What It Does
SuiteDash does everything: CRM, client portals, project management, invoicing, marketing automation, support desk, LMS. All for a flat monthly fee regardless of team size.
Key Features
- Everything from CRM to help desk
- White-label client portals
- Project management
- Invoicing and payments
- Marketing automation
- Learning management
- Flat-rate pricing (not per-user)
Why Choose Over HoneyBook
Value. A 5-person team on SuiteDash pays $19-99/month total. On HoneyBook, that's $80-330/month. If you'll use most features, SuiteDash offers dramatically more for less.
Pricing
- Start: $19/month (flat rate)
- Thrive: $49/month
- Pinnacle: $99/month
Trade-offs
- Steep learning curve
- Interface isn't as polished as HoneyBook
- Overwhelming number of features
- Setup takes days, not minutes
Best For: Growing teams and agencies who want maximum features without per-user pricing.
6. Moxie - Best for Solo Simplicity
If HoneyBook feels like too much, Moxie (formerly Hectic) strips things down for solo freelancers.
What It Does
Moxie is a streamlined freelancer tool covering proposals, contracts, invoicing, time tracking, and basic project management. Less feature-dense than HoneyBook but cleaner and simpler.
Key Features
- Proposals and contracts
- Invoicing and payments
- Time tracking
- Basic project management
- Client dashboard
- Expense tracking
- Lead pipeline
Why Choose Over HoneyBook
Simpler and more focused. If HoneyBook's automation and workflows feel like overkill for your solo practice, Moxie gives you the essentials without the complexity.
Pricing
- Free tier available (limited)
- Pro: $16/month
Trade-offs
- Less powerful automation
- Fewer integrations
- Smaller feature set
- Less suited for teams
Best For: Solo freelancers who want clean, simple business tools without the learning curve of bigger platforms.

Can You Use HoneyBook + Another Tool?
Yes. Many freelancers keep HoneyBook for what it does best (booking, contracts, invoicing) and add a focused tool for what it doesn't:
- HoneyBook + KeepPostd: Booking and billing via HoneyBook, project status via KeepPostd
- HoneyBook + Copilot: HoneyBook for acquisition, Copilot for ongoing portal
- HoneyBook + Notion: HoneyBook for business, Notion for project documentation
You don't have to replace HoneyBook entirely. Sometimes adding one focused tool fills the gap.
